Causes of Aviation Accidents

First off, let’s talk about the pilots. They often take the blame for mess-ups in the air. Handling an aircraft isn’t a walk in the park – it needs piles of training, a brain full of technical stuff, good reflexes, and smart flying plans. Imagine being in a video game, only real; pilots can lose their bearings, especially when flying by instruments alone, causing them to stall or, worse, crash. That’s why it’s wise to have a legal eagle, or rather, a pilot-savvy attorney in your corner when trouble arises (Wilson Kehoe Winingham).

Another critical factor is how well the crew works together—Cockpit Resource Management. In simpler words, it’s making sure every pilot knows their role and that everyone in the cockpit can pipe up with concerns without feeling like the copilot on a silent movie set. Fail in that, and the risk of accidents skyrockets.

Liability in Aviation Accidents

Figuring out who’s at fault isn’t as clear as a cloudless sky. Air traffic controllers can be as guilty as pilots if they mess up. They’re like the conductors of an airborne orchestra, keeping planes apart and sending them down the right paths. If they slip up, flights can stumble into disastrous collisions. That’s why getting your hands on control tower recordings post-crash is a must-do.

Blame can scatter all over: from careless air traffic controllers and pilots to broken parts, nasty weather, or even feathery invaders like birds. Pinpointing who’s got the hot potato in aviation accidents isn’t straightforward (1000Attorneys).

According to FAA stats, loss of control in flight is a major culprit behind deadly general aviation mishaps from 2009 to 2018. Often, it’s pilots stalling the plane and failing to recover, leading to crashes.

Legal Timeline and Deadlines

Getting tangled up in the legal world after an aviation mishap in sunny California? Well, buckle up and let’s cut right to the chase. You need to know when and how to file your claims to get what you deserve for any bumps and bruises or busted belongings you’ve suffered.

Statute of Limitations for Claims

So, here’s the lowdown on the ticking clock. If you’re caught up in an aviation mishap in California, you generally have a two-year window starting from the nasty day it happened to toss in a personal injury or wrongful death claim (here’s more from Danko Law). That’s a solid time frame thanks to California Code of Civil Procedure § 335.1, giving you a chance to seek your due compensation.

Now, if it’s stuff, not people, that got damaged—say your propeller clock or wing-shaped sofa got wrecked—you’ve got three years to shout your grievances (Khashan Law Firm spills the details). Some funky situations might change things up, so having a wise California aviation accident lawyer on your side is a smart move to keep it all straight.

Filing Deadlines for Government Claims

Here’s the scoop if you’re having a chat with Uncle Sam or any government buddies. You have a slim six months to pipe up with your claim, according to California Code, GOV 911.2 (Danko Law explains further). The system’s crafted this way so the government can work its magic quickly and maybe even sort things without a courtroom drama.
